Developer environments are critical to ensuring your development teams are setup to do their best work. Right now everyone on your team likely has a slightly different setup of their environment (editor, extensions, tools) installed on their local machine.
GitHub includes the ability to create a cloud based development environment called a codespace that is configured via a dev container (devcontainer.json
) code file detailed within a repository. The file details how a developer environment should be supplied consistently from the cloud to every developer in the team who wants to create one in a self-serve manner. This can include the editor, extensions and tools we want to have available.
Our repository includes an application written in .NET that will deploy to Azure using Infrastructure-as-Code via a language called Bicep. We will want to configure our codespace to have tooling included to work with .NET, ARM (infrastructure-as-code) and the Azure CLI.

Add a new devcontainer file in your repository placed in a
.devcontainer
directory that defines your codespace. Ensure your devcontainer file is based on a docker image for .NET, notably "mcr.microsoft.com/devcontainers/dotnet:0-6.0" for the hackathon supplied application on .NET 6.0.HINT: - VS Code Dev Containers Extension has a feature here that will simplify the process of creating a devcontainer file for many scenarios, or the below code snippet should be a good starter for our hackathon.
{
"name": "C# (.NET)",
"image": "mcr.microsoft.com/devcontainers/dotnet:0-6.0",
"features": {
"ghcr.io/devcontainers/features/azure-cli:1": {
"installBicep": true,
"version": "latest"
}
}
}
-
Configure your devcontainer to add a feature for the Azure CLI. (the above code snippet includes this)
-
Start a new codespace in your repository testing .NET and Azure CLIs are available.
